Every L&D team thinks everyone else has AI figured out. Almost nobody does. Ross G recently ran structured interviews with 12 Mindtools Kineo customers, spanning tech, financial services, pharmaceuticals, energy, media and more, to find out what's really happening on the ground. In this week's episode, Ross D and Cammy Bean join Ross G to discuss his findings. We cover: Why every L&D team believes it is falling behind Where teams are continuing to invest at a time when budgets are constrained Why AI ambition keeps stalling at the governance stage During the episode, Cammy referenced a LinkedIn post titled 'L&D Overboard' by Srishti Sehgal.
